East Cheshire NHS Trust is recruiting for an exciting opportunity within Undergraduate Medical Education. We are seeking a new Clinical Education Fellow to join our established team, supporting the delivery of medical education to students from both the University of Manchester & the University of Buckingham.
The role involves contributing to the delivery of high-quality medical education in a safe & supportive environment, enabling students to meet their learning outcomes, enhance their clinical reasoning & assessment skills & progress toward greater independence in their medical training.
The post-holder will also be expected to work on the wards in an educational capacity at least once per week for a minimum of 1PA, supporting student learning in the clinical setting. This may include:
-
Facilitating student participation in ward rounds/supporting communication & examination skills practice /delivering bedside and opportunistic teaching/assisting students in performing clinical skills & achieving required sign-offs.
-
Current clinical departments requiring additional educational support include Respiratory (wd 11), Gastroenterology (wd 3) & Endocrinology (wd 7). Exact hours & rota for these sessions can be reviewed on discussion with the successful applicant
Main duties of the job
-
Active contribution to delivery of medical student teaching.
-
Ensuring all teaching content is aligned with the relevant university curricula and GMC Medical Licensing Assessment (MLA) requirements.
-
Acting as examiner for mock and end of year OSCE examinations in Manchester,Crewe and/or Buckingham campus*
-
Engaging with quarterly meetings with Clinical Education Fellows and faculty at other LEPs for both University of Manchester and University of Buckingham, some of which may be off site*
-
Identifying student concerns and escalating these appropriately to the senior education team to ensure timely support and providing pastoral support to students.
-
Supporting clinical supervisors with assessments, development plans, and up-skilling initiatives across multiple learner cohorts
-
Taking shared responsibility for fair and equal allocation of teaching sessions across the Education Fellow team
-
Actively participating in PGME and UGME team meetings
-
Engaging in Quality Improvement and Assurance processes in relation to the Undergraduateprogrammes
There will also be the opportunity to engage in formal postgraduate study (e.g PGCert) or other professional development in medical education, which will be funded as part of the fellow role.
